In the fast-paced agency world, working efficiently is not a nice extra, but a necessity. With oha! we have decided to use the tool Motion to test. Testing, in fact, because we often have the feeling that we can no longer cope with the daily challenges, which in turn affects our productivity and work-life balance. The aim: to use our working time productively and fight common productivity traps (which we all know...). At the moment, we are particularly concerned with these:
1. incorrect prioritization of tasks
We've all been there: we put off some projects because they seem less urgent, only to realize that they should suddenly be a top priority. The wrong prioritization leads to unnecessary stress and hectic last-minute actions. Motion helps us to prioritize tasks objectively and based on real deadlines, not according to the „who shouts the loudest“ principle.
2. the dear everyday life
Between dentist appointments and yoga classes, tasks can quickly become emotional rather than rational. Motion helps us to keep a cool head and work through our to-do list systematically so that private appointments no longer interfere with our workload, but are integrated harmoniously.
3. internal projects vs. customer projects
Internal projects tend to slip down the priority list, especially if they have no fixed deadlines. This often leads to important development or optimization work being left undone. With Motion, we plan to integrate these tasks into our day-to-day business on an equal footing in order to grow not only externally but also internally in the long term.
4. work-life balance
It is a personal concern of mine that our team receives the best possible support not only at work, but also in their free time. Motion should help to create a clear separation between work and private life. The aim is for every employee to be able to close their laptop in the afternoon with a good feeling, knowing that all tasks are controlled and planned.
5. emails, emails, emails
Nothing can disrupt the flow of work like the constant pinging of new emails or messages. In the flood of newsletters and requests, it's easy to lose track and valuable work time. With Motion, we have defined fixed times for processing emails to ensure that our team stays focused and can work productively without being constantly interrupted by incoming messages.
6. fixed lunch breaks at last
Especially on hectic days, the lunch break tends to be overlooked. To ensure that our team stays healthy and energized, even with busy schedules, we have integrated the lunch break as an integral part of our Motion working day. This not only promotes physical health, but also mental clarity and creativity.
